"Went for afternoon tea with my wife, using an 'experience ' voucher from a well known site, costing £35.99 absolute disaster! The description said 'sit down in the sophisticated dining room and tuck into a section of finger sandwiches, tantalising cakes, pastries, macarons and scones with clotted cream and jam. You won 't want this afternoon to end! ' Trust me, we could not get out of their quick enough and go and find somewhere to get something to eat. The sophisticated dining room was a large, cold room with only a couple of other diners, sticky wooden tables, with no table cloths, just a flimsy paper napkin and a knife and fork. We ordered a coffee and a tea, which came in the smallest teapot, I have ever seen. Later in the meal, when we asked for another drink, we were told that was extra and were charged another £5.70. The food was nothing like as described or pictured on the website. A sad looking selection of sandwiches four quarters each of thin sliced bread one containing a very small piece of processed ham, a second mashed up egg, third was some sort of fish, not sure if it was salmon or tuna; and finally some sort of green leaf with something wet on top it looked like the sandwich had been made days earlier and then sat upon! No pastries or macarons but the two scones with clotted cream and two little pots of jam were OK, however the remaining small cakes were dreadful, none of them were fresh there were two eclairs that were inedible, either the cream or chocolate was off and they were very dry; two little red velvet cakes, which again were dry and horrible; and finally two small pieces of carrot cake that were the least objectionable but again very dry. When we told the waitress the eclairs, she said she would tell the chef but no offer of an alternative. True, it was an unforgettable experience, but not in the way we had expected! We have had afternoon teas in top hotels, pubs, cafes and well known garden centres and nothing came close to being as bad as this meal. Needless to say we will never return and would strongly advise caution if anyone is thinking of going here."
